Official: Joe Jonas to Open for Britney Spears' European Tour

The 'See No More' singer can't wait to join Britney in the European leg of her 'Femme Fatale' tour this fall.

Joe Jonas has his dream come true. After confirming that he will support his idol Britney Spears at her New Jersey concert, he has now been tapped to open for the pop singer when she travels across Europe for her "Femme Fatale" show.

An excited Joe told People, "She was the first girl I ever had a poster on my wall of, and her album was the first CD I ever bought." The "See No More" singer added, "It's so funny to think I had that on my wall and here I am about to perform with her."

Joe first met Britney a few years ago at MTV Video Music Awards. "She's a very sweet lady," he said of the Southern Belle. Last March, they were actually reported to tour together, but the rumor died down when Nicki Minaj was confirmed as "Femme Fatale" guest.

The Jonas Brothers lead singer now can't wait to hit the road with the "I Wanna Go" singer. He is scheduled to support her in 10 shows across the pond with performances in Sweden, Germany, the Netherlands, France, Ireland and the United Kingdom.

"I'm really looking forward to being part of this," he gushed. "I'll be playing more music than I have the past few times I've performed live so far. It's going to be really fun to perform some of my music from the album [Fastlife]."

This indeed will be a cross promotion for Joe's debut album which was recently pushed back from September 6 to October 11. The European leg of the tour will kick off September 22, continue throughout October and wrap up in early November.
